New Financial Instrument Listing Announcement - “ELN001”
The Standard Bank of South Africa Limited
New Financial Instrument Listing Announcement - “ELN001”
Stock Code: ELN001
ISIN Code: ZAG000160086
The JSE Limited has granted a listing to The Standard Bank of
South Africa Limited – ELN001 Equity Index-Linked Notes due 06
June 2024 - sponsored by The Standard Bank of South Africa
Limited (acting through its Corporate and Investment Banking
Division), under its Structured Note Programme.
Authorised Programme size ZAR60,000,000,000
Total notes issued
(including current issue) ZAR36 853 108 202.43
Full Note details are as follows:
Issue Date: 06 June 2019
Nominal Issued: ZAR96,600,000
Final Redemption Amount: Per the Applicable Pricing
Supplement (Formula Driven)
Trade Type: Price
Issue Price: 99.98675%
Maturity Date: 06 June 2024
Interest Commencement Date: Not Applicable
Redemption Basis: Equity Index-Linked
Business Day Count/Convention: Actual/365 (Fixed) and
Following Business Day
Books Close: Monday 27 May 2024 until 06
June 2024 i.e. the Maturity
Date
Last day to register: 17h00 on 24 May 2024, or if
such day is not a Business
Day, the Business Day before
each books closed period
Placement Agent: The Standard Bank of South
Africa Limited
Debt Security subject
to guarantee; security
or credit enhancement: Not Applicable
Additional Terms and Conditions: Investors should study the
Pricing Supplement for full details of the specific terms and
conditions applicable to this specific issuance.
Notes will be deposited in the Central Depository (“CSD”) and
settlement will take place electronically in terms of JSE Rules.
